视频发射机支持

视频发射机 (VTX) 支持允许(飞行)控制器控制连接的视频发射机。根据所使用的 VTX 和协议,可控制的组件包括视频波段、视频频道、发射机功率和坑道模式。支持的协议包括 SmartAudio、IRC Tramp 和 TBS Crossfire (CRSF)。

备注

并非所有声称支持 SmartAudio 的视频发射机都完全支持该规范,发射机可能不提供某些功能,或以非标准方式实现某些功能。如有疑问,请查阅制造商的文档。

如何设置视频发射器支持

要启用视频发射器支持,您需要设置以下参数并重启(飞行)控制器:

  • 设置 VTX_ENABLE 为 1 以启用视频发送器支持。如果没有启用适当的视频发送器协议,虽然启用了视频发送器支持,但并不能实现任何功能,如下所述。

智能音频

SmartAudio 是单线协议,因此您需要将 VTX 的 SmartAudio 引脚连接到要使用的串行端口的 TX 引脚。您还需要确保 VTX 已配置为 SmartAudio 控制。例如,如果连接到串行端口 5:

  • 设置 serial5_protocol 到 37 以启用智能音频。

  • 设置 serial5_options 为 4 以启用 SmartAudio 所需的半双工功能。根据您的视频发射机,可能需要启用 TX_PullDown 选项,因此 68 将是正确的值。

  • 设置 SERIAL5_BAUD 至 4800 以设置 SmartAudio 波特率

../_images/VTX-smartaudio.jpg

CRSF(交叉火力)

CRSF 是一种双向协议,需要同时连接串行端口的 TX 和 RX。请按照 CRSF 遥测的说明设置 CRSF 支持(请参阅 穿越火线和 ELRS 遥控系统).如果您只想使用 CRSF 来支持 VTX,那么(还是以 SERIAL5 为例) serial5_protocol 应设置为 29,而不是 23。您还需要确保 VTX 配置为 CRSF 控制。

将 CRSF 用于 RC/Telem 和 VTX 控制时,必须禁用 Open TX 发射机上的 "我的 VTX "支持。请按照发射机的说明操作。在这种情况下,您必须将(飞行)控制器的 UART 连接到 CRSF 接收机,然后将 CRSF 接收机连接到 VTX,以转发 CRSF 命令,而不能直接使用 CRSF 连接到 FC,因为接收机和 VTX 都使用两个 UART。

重新启动(飞行)控制器并为视频发射器供电。启动时,您将看到一条视频信息,显示当前的视频设置。所有视频设置都存储在 VTX_x 默认情况下,这些参数将被更改,以反映当前配置的 VTX 设置。启动后,您可以修改这些设置,它们将反映在 VTX 配置中。

../_images/VTX-crsf.jpg ./_images/VTX-both.jpg

浸入式 RC 流浪汉

  • 将视频发射器的 telemtry 引脚连接到用于控制(飞行)控制器的 UART 的 TX 引脚。

  • 设置 serial5_protocol 如果使用 SERIAL5 连接 VTX,则 = 44

视频发射器设置

  • 设置 VTX_BAND 来修改 VTX 频段。

  • 设置 VTX_CHANNEL 来修改 VTX 通道。

  • 设置 VTX_FREQ 来修改 VTX 频率。频段/信道和频率是互斥的,如果您设置了频段和/或信道,频率将自动更新。如果您设置了频率,则频段/信道将自动更新。除非发射机解锁,否则并不支持所有频率、频道和频段。请在这样做之前咨询当地法规。如果您选择了不支持的频率,则当前频率将不会更改。

  • 设置 VTX_POWER 来修改以 mw 为单位的 VTX 功率。并非所有发射机都支持所有功率值。特别是在欧洲,默认情况下只允许 25 毫瓦。要允许其他值,发射机必须解锁。如果您选择了发射机不支持的功率级别,则实际功率值不会改变。

  • 设置 VTX_MAX_POWER 以 mw 为单位设置 VTX 允许的最大功率。该功能用于 RCx_OPTION = 94,可通过开关或拨盘改变 VTX 功率。

  • 设置 VTX_OPTIONS 来设置 VTX 的选项。最常见的选项是设置第 0 位,在支持的情况下将 VTX 置入坑道模式。其他选项可用于在上膛时重置坑道模式和/或在撤膛时设置坑道模式(第 1 位和第 2 位)。选项位及其作用如下所示:

VTX_OPTIONS 马衔

功能

0

直接将 VTX 设置为 PIT 模式(如果有的话

1

上膛时复位上述第 0 位

2

解除警报时设置上述第 0 位

3

解锁:解锁某些发射机的频率和波段

4

在请求中添加前导零字节(某些发射机需要)

5

使用 1 个停止位。某些使用非兼容(iNAV)信息的发射机需要此功能

6

忽略 CRC 校验。某些使用非兼容信息传送的发射机需要此功能

7

未来(目前不工作)

备注

根据发射机品牌的不同,"解锁 "的方式也不同。此外,使用解锁频率/功率级别可能会违反当地法律和限制。

设置视频发射器设置

视频发射器设置可通过多种方式更改,但始终要通过 VTX_x 参数。因此,任何宣传 VTX 控制的选项都会设置一个 VTX_x 参数,进而与协议后端连接。以下是目前可以修改视频发射器设置的方法:

  • 通过地面站修改参数

  • 通过 RC 开关为发射机供电 (RCx_OPTION = 94).在此设置下,RC 通道被解释为 6 位开关(将 PWM 范围划分为 1200 至 1800),然后根据 VTX_MAX_POWER.例如,如果最大功率为 200-499mW,开关位置 0 则为 0mW(基坑模式),1 和 2 则为 25mW,3 和 4 则为 100mW,5 则为 200mW。

  • 通过 OSD 修改参数(参见 基于 OSD 的参数菜单)

  • 通过 CRSF OpenTX lua 脚本(或 OpenTX AgentX lua 脚本)修改参数 - 仅适用于 CRSF

  • 支持 Spektrum VTX。Spektrum 发射机上的 VTX 设置将由 DSMX 或 SRXL2 驱动程序翻译,并更新相应的 VTX 设置。